Description of 685 West End Avenue
685 West End Avenue is a 17-story, 93-unit cooperative on the Upper West Side dating back to 1928 and featuring Neo-Renaissance and Gothic architectural influences. This full-service building has 24-hour door staff, a live-in superintendent, bike room, laundry room, private storage, and beautifully landscaped roof deck with views of the Hudson River.
Pied-a-terres are allowed, pets are welcome, and washer/dryers are permitted with board approval. The building is well situated near Riverside Park, Broadway and Columbus Square shopping, iconic restaurants like Barney Greengrass and Tal Bagels, multiple houses of worship, and the 1/2/3 trains, B/C trains, and abundant bus service.
